ATG proudly presented two-time Tony Award-Nominee Kate Baldwin as Desiree in our season premiere of Stephen Sondheim’s A Little Night Music. Written by Hugh Wheeler, this sophisticated farce was awarded six 1973 Tony Awards including Best Musical and Best Original Score, and is based on Ingmar Bergman's comedy of manners, Smiles of a Summer Night, set in 1900 Sweden. It explores the tangled web of hidden (and not-so-hidden) affairs, desires and deceits and features one of Sondheim’s most cherished songs, "Send in The Clowns." 

The musical was directed by Broadway veteran and Tony Award-nominee Hunter Foster, with musical supervision by Keith Levenson.

Our second show was the world premiere of Canned Goods, a provocative new play  by Erik Kahn.  It tells the gripping tale of the secret incident that launched World War II and is a harrowing account of Hitler’s devious strategy to fake an attack on Germany to justify his invasion of Poland in 1939.  

The production was directed by Charlotte Cohn. Please visit our production page for additional details.
